The Allure of Oud:

Aromatic Journey: Oud, also known as agarwood, is a rich and complex fragrance derived from the resin of Southeast Asian trees. Its aroma unfolds like a story, beginning with earthy and woody notes, transitioning to sweet and balsamic nuances, and leaving a lingering scent that is both sophisticated and slightly smoky.
Beyond Compare: Unlike any other fragrance, oud possesses a depth and complexity that is truly captivating. Its versatility allows it to be enjoyed on its own or layered with other aromas to create unique and personalized olfactory experiences.
Crafting Your Signature Scent:

Selecting the Right Oud: With various types of oud available, choosing the right one is crucial. Indonesian oud is known for its sweet and woody profile, while Indian oud offers a smokier and more intense experience. Experiment with different varieties to discover your personal preference.
The Art of Layering: Elevate your oud fragrance by layering it with complementary scents. Consider floral notes like rose or jasmine to add a touch of sweetness, or citrusy notes like bergamot or lemon for a refreshing twist. Explore the art of diffusing or burning different fragrances simultaneously to create a multi-dimensional olfactory experience.
Transforming Your Space:

Strategic Placement: To optimize the sensory experience, strategically place your chosen fragrance diffusers or candles. Entryways, living rooms, and bedrooms are ideal locations to welcome guests and create a relaxing atmosphere.
Seasonal Considerations: Adapt your fragrance choices to the seasons. During warmer months, opt for lighter and citrusy notes that complement the oud. In cooler seasons, explore warmer and spicier scents like cinnamon or clove to create a cozy and inviting ambiance.
Beyond the Fragrance:

Candles and Diffusers: Choose from a variety of elegantly designed diffusers and candles to disperse the oud fragrance throughout your space. Opt for natural wax candles and high-quality diffusers for a clean and long-lasting experience.
Potpourri and Incense: Enhance the ambiance with oud-infused potpourri placed in decorative bowls or explore the ancient practice of burning oud incense for a ritualistic and meditative touch.
